Göran Andersson for Upsala Verkstad, vase.
Cylindrical stoneware vase with a light grey ground glaze and hand-decorated blue pattern in organic, repeating forms. Short neck with a subtly profiled rim. Stamped to the base with UE Sweden, Upsala Verkstad and model number 7052 G.

Origin: Sweden.
Designer: Göran Andersson.
Material: Stoneware.
Dimensions: H. 20 cm, D. 10 cm.
Period: 1960s.
Condition: Excellent condition with minor signs of wear.

Bio:
Göran Andersson 1936–2014 was a Swedish ceramic artist and designer active at Upsala Verkstad during the 1960s. He is recognised for a disciplined modernist approach, combining clear vessel forms with strong, graphic hand-painted decoration. His work reflects the Scandinavian post-war interest in structure, repetition and controlled ornament, and is today regarded as a characteristic expression of Swedish studio ceramics from the period.
